What are the most common auto repair issues for cars in Simpsonville, SC?

Due to our hot, humid summers and occasional winter cold snaps, common issues include battery failure from extreme temperatures, AC system repairs, and brake wear from stop-and-go traffic on roads like Fairview Road and Main Street. Corrosion from road treatments used on nearby I-385 can also accelerate undercarriage and exhaust system wear.

When should I seek service for my check engine light in Simpsonville?

Seek service immediately if the light is flashing or if you notice performance issues, as this could indicate a serious problem. For a steady light, schedule a diagnostic scan promptly; many Simpsonville shops offer this service to identify issues early, preventing more costly repairs from developing, especially given our climate's strain on engine components.

What is a typical price range for common auto repairs in Simpsonville?

Prices vary by shop and vehicle, but local averages for common services are: brake pad replacement ($150-$300 per axle), battery replacement ($120-$250), and oil change ($35-$70). Always request a written estimate first, as labor rates can differ between shops in Simpsonville and nearby Greenville.

Are there any local driving conditions in Simpsonville that affect my car's maintenance schedule?

Yes. Frequent short trips in Simpsonville's growing suburban area prevent engines from fully warming up, leading to moisture buildup and increased wear. We recommend following the "severe service" schedule in your manual, which includes more frequent oil changes and inspections, due to this driving pattern and our humid climate.
